There is a well-established relationship between high levels of vitamin D and low risk of developing colon cancer.
But what about AFTER you have colon cancer?
The new SUNSHINE study investigated how high doses of vitamin D could impact colon cancer treatments.
The study, published in the journal JAMA, looked at 139 people with previously untreated metastatic colorectal cancer and split them into 2 groups:
- The high dose group took 8000 IU of vitamin D each day for 2 weeks and then switched to 4000 IU a day.
- The low dose group took 400 IU (the recommended daily allowance for vitamin D is 800 IU a day for adults) each day for the whole study.
Both groups took standard chemotherapy during the trial.
At the end, the high-dose group was less likely to experience progression of their cancer or death in almost 2 years of follow-up than the low-dose group.
This means that vitamin D can help SLOW the growth of colon cancer… and keep it from killing you, too!
